Hi all,

For the past 3 days, I’ve noticed my free chlorine level hasn’t dropped. Is it normal for chlorine levels to stop dropping in cooler weather? Lately, it’s been about 60F, and my water temp has been around 50F.

This is my first time maintaining a pool in the winter, so I’m not sure what’s considered normal.

Thanks for the help!
 
Yes, chlorine consumption slows down in the winter months. All due to chilly water which usually means less swimming, less bacteria/organic matter, and a lower angle of the sun. Enjoy the savings in chlorine. :) Just stick with the FC/CYA Levels to keep the FC balanced to the CYA and you'll be fine.
